About this listen
In The Ticket That Exploded, William S. Burroughs' grand "cut-up" trilogy, which starts with The Soft Machine and continues through Nova Express, reaches its climax as inspector Lee and the Nova Police engage the Nova Mob in a decisive battle for the planet. Only Burroughs could make such a nightmare vision of scientists and combat troops, of ad men and con men, whose deceitful language has spread like an incurable disease, be at once so frightening and so enthralling.
